Output 9f524486c01a6233250fdcbb3c27946cb2702c1871a1856ac1244ec79c44e98f:0

value
28572392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da60861f5d8a872dfe52b1eb8a83050c60cd0d22 OP_EQUAL
address
3MbgrxkbE8G27xdoMXG8gdESxyYA31LEfx
transaction
9f524486c01a6233250fdcbb3c27946cb2702c1871a1856ac1244ec79c44e98f
spent
true